Millipore Corporation announced today that a new brochure (PB1200EN00) detailing its NovAseptic line of mixers is now available.

NovAseptic mixers offer solutions for mixing throughout the process line and are designed for a variety of mixing applications in the pharmaceutical and biotechnology industries. The mixers are magnetically-driven, which minimizes contamination risk, and are bottom-mounted for low level mixing and easy maintenance. In addition, all models can be cleaned- and sterilized-in-place.
